This paper reports a case of thyroid carcinoma in a crossbreed domestic feline, 10 years old, female. Laboratory and imaging exams were performed at the veterinary laboratory Delort in Jundiaí (SP). The patient presented weight loss and volume increase in the ventral cervical region at the beginning of the condition. During abdominal ultrasound and thorax radiography, pleural effusion and pulmonary opacification by miliary pattern were observed, which suggested a pulmonary metastasis. After the findings, the patient was referred to the oncologist, in addition to the collection of material for cytological examination, where the diagnosis of carcinoma was confirmed.(AU)

Biliary neoplasms are uncommon in cats and affect older animals. A 12-year-old female crossbreed cat showed prostration, lethargy, apathy, and severe jaundice. Ultrasonography showed distention of the gallbladder associated with severe obstruction of the bile ducts with thickening of the biliary wall, forming amorphous masses of irregular contour and heterogeneous appearance directed to the lumen measuring up to 2 cm. Necropsy showed a gallbladder with a yellowish and soft nodule measuring 3 × 3 cm, compressing the extrahepatic bile duct, occluding the passage of bile. There were also firm, yellowish multifocal to coalescing nodules in the liver, ranging from 0.5 to 1 cm, affecting 10% of the organ, in addition to lungs with firm, yellowish multifocal nodules ranging from 0.2 to 0.5 cm, affecting 20% of the organ. Histologically, gallbladder and bile ducts had malignant epithelial neoplastic proliferation, which was organized into multiple papillary and ductal projections, separated by moderate fibrovascular stroma compatible with gallbladder adenocarcinoma. The liver and lungs also contained neoplastic structures with a ductal appearance and papilliform projections identical to those observed in the gallbladder. The immunohistochemical examination (IHC) showed intense positive staining of epithelial neoplastic cells for pan-cytokeratin (AE1/AE3) and no staining for vimentin (Clone V9). The diagnosis of gallbladder adenocarcinoma with metastasis in the liver and lungs was established based on the clinical, macroscopic, histopathological, and immunohistochemical findings.(AU)

The molecular background of canine mast cell tumors (MCT) has been extensively investigated; however, the dynamic molecular changes that occur during carcinogenesis and metastasis are not fully understood. This study aimed to evaluate the incidence of mutations in the c-KIT proto-oncogene in canine MCTs and relative draining regional lymph nodes. Suspected or confirmed lymph node metastasis was classified accordingly to the HN Weishaar classification. The study included 34 dogs diagnosed with MCT; 19 patients were enrolled prospectively. These dogs had the primary MCT and regional lymph node resected and analyzed simultaneously. The second group was evaluated retrospectively and included fifteen patients resectioning the primary MCT without evaluation of regional lymph node. Analyzes of c-KIT mutation were performed for all primary MCTs and, in the first group, compared between primary MCT and HN-classified metastasis. Internal tandem duplications (ITD) in exon 11 of the c-KIT gene were detected in 20% of patients. Ten of the nineteen patients (52%) in the first group presented mast cell infiltration in the regional lymph node, and ITD in exon 11 of the c-KIT gene was detected in five and two dogs from Groups 1 and 2, respectively. ITD c-KIT mutations are common in canine MCT and may be found in the draining lymph node metastases/mast cell infiltrates in the absence of mutation of the primary tumor. Evaluation of c-KIT mutation in the primary tumor and metastases may be informative for defining both prognosis and therapeutic options in MCT cases.

Background: Several neoplasms can affect the perianal region, being the hepatic adenoma and the anal sac adenocarcinoma (ASAC), which is considered the most frequent. The ASAC is a malignant neoplasm originating from the secretory epithelium of the perianal apocrine glands and is rarely seen in veterinary medicine. The ASAC occurs mainly in adult to elderly canines with high metastasis rates. Patients may be asymptomatic or manifest discomfort and behavioral changes. In the presence of metastasis, the most frequent clinical signs are inappetence, coughing, dyspnea, and colorectal obstruction. Given this scenario, this paper aims to describe the clinical presentation, diagnostic examination, and necropsy findings of a Cocker Spaniel with ASAC and metastasis in the vertebral body, spinal cord, and cauda equina. Case: A 8-year-old neutered male Cocker Spaniel (12 kg of body mass) with a clinical history of non-ambulatory paraparesis was evaluated. The patient also presented tenesmus, difficulty to defecate, and the presence of nodules in the anal sac area. On the neurological examination, asymmetrical changes compatible with injury between L4-S3 were found. A complete blood count, serum biochemistry, and imaging exams such as plain radiography, abdominal ultrasonography (US), and magnetic resonance imaging (MRI) were requested. Blood count revealed anemia and neutrophilic leukocytosis and hypercalcemia. The liver showed increased echogenicity and thickened pancreas in the abdominal US scan. A slightly heterogeneous, vascularized mass with irregular borders was identified in the topographic region of the sublumbar lymph nodes; MRI images demonstrated an expansile formation in the ventral region of the lumbosacral spine, corresponding to the sublumbar lymph nodes and interruption of the cerebrospinal fluid at L5, suggestive of compression of the spinal cord and cauda equina. A presumptive diagnosis of perianal neoplasm with metastasis was made based on the complementary exams. The dog was referred to necropsy, which revealed a 4 cm tumor in the perianal region that invaded the pelvic canal. Multifocal nodules were present on the lung surface, liver, and kidneys, suggesting metastasis. On the cross-section of the spine, one could note the presence of the tumor in the vertebral bodies, spinal cord, and cauda equina from L5 to S3. Even with histopathological evaluation of the tumor, only the immunohistochemical analysis allowed us to confirm the anal sac adenocarcinoma. Discussion: Adenomas and carcinomas are perianal gland neoplasms common in adult and elderly male dogs; the Cocker Spaniel breed is among the most affected. The clinical signs presented by the patient, such as tenesmus and difficulty in adopting the posture of defecation, are common, although neurological changes are rare. As for metastasis, carcinomas of the perianal region present high chances of metastasis to organs including the liver, kidneys, and lungs, both lymphatically and hematogenously, but few studies have related these factors to neurological alterations due to metastasis. We concluded that metastases from carcinomas to the spine must be considered a possible differential diagnosis in cases of patients presenting clinical signs that are compatible with spinal cord compression and a history of previous neoplasm.

Background: Mast cell tumors (MCTs) are neoplasms originating from mast cells, which can be well or poorly differentiated. They are considered the most commonly diagnosed malignant cutaneous neoplasm in dogs; however, intranasal forms are still little reported. Thus, this study seeks to report a case of unilateral intranasal MCT exhibiting submandibular lymph node metastasis. Case: A 11-year-old-and-4-month-old dog of undefined breed (UB), weighing 41 kg, was referred to the Veterinary Medical Teaching Hospital of the University of Passo Fundo (UPF), in the state of Rio Grande do Sul, Brazil. Presenting a clinical history of bilateral purulent nasal secretion, accompanied by sneezing in the two months prior to admission, in addition to vomiting and diarrhea. Auxiliary tests were requested, including skull X-ray, cytology of the nasal cavity with a swab, and collection of material from the submandibular lymph node directly through cytology with a needle. Cytological findings from the right nasal cavity were consistent with mast cell tumors (MCTs). Cytological analysis of the left nasal cavity was compatible with dysplasia/cellular reactivity. A heterogeneous population of cells was detected on cytology of the right submandibular lymph node. These findings were consistent with MCT lymph node metastasis. Skull radiography showed an increase in both opacity and soft tissue extension, surpassing the palate, from the canine tooth through the caudal region of the maxillary sinuses to the last molar, without bone destruction. The dog was then admitted for an abdominal ultrasound, which showed no changes in the spleen or liver. The leukocyte count showed mild lymphopenia and the presence of reactive lymphocytes. Through the buffy coat, the presence of rare round cells, compatible with circulating mast cells, was detected. Due to the biological behavior of the neoplasm and its anatomical location, the established therapy was based on the use of vinblastine and prednisolone. The patient did not show any clinical improvements. In a joint decision with the patient's guardian, the dog was euthanized. Discussion: Intranasal MCTs commonly present progressive and intermittent unilateral epitaxis, mucopurulent nasal discharge, dyspnea, and ocular discharge. Several anatomical sites were associated with more aggressive neoplastic phenotypes; those with an unfavorable prognosis were mainly those present in the oral and intranasal mucosa. Cytopathological examination is considered a highly sensitive method for the diagnosis of MCTs. Metastases are present in more than 90% of mucosal MCTs, usually affecting regional lymph nodes and associated with a poor prognosis. Radiography is considered a useful test in determining the size and location of tumors in the nasal cavity. Chemotherapy plays an important role in the treatment, especially in cases like the one described in this report, in which surgical excision is not possible due to the anatomical location of the neoplasm. Intranasal MCTs are uncommon in dogs. In this case, he presented aggressive, metastatic behavior and a poor response to antineoplastic therapy. Furthermore, due to the location of these tumors, they may be clinically similar to a number of other upper respiratory tract diseases, posing a diagnostic challenge. Therefore, it is essential that the search for differential diagnoses be carried out through auxiliary tests, such as cytology and imaging.

ABSTRACT: Canine mammary neoplasms with malignant mesenchymal components, such as carcinosarcomas and sarcomas, belong to an uncommon and histologically heterogeneous group. Little is known about the biological behavior of these histogenic variants. This study aimed to compare the clinicopathological characteristics and the COX-2 immunohistochemical expression of different histologic subtypes of carcinosarcomas and sarcomas. Samples of 23 carcinosarcomas and 15 sarcomas from the mammary glands of female dogs were studied. Medical records were reviewed to obtain clinical data. Subsequently, histology microscope slides were analyzed to assess for mesenchymal subtypes, necrosis, vascular invasion, histologic grades, and lymph node metastasis. Immunohistochemistry was used to assess the COX-2 expression. The malignant mesenchymal proliferation was categorized into osteosarcomas (23/40), fibrosarcomas (5/40), liposarcomas (6/40) and chondrosarcomas (4/40). The osteosarcomatous differentiation was the most predominant type among the sarcomas and carcinosarcomas and was associated with vascular invasion (P=0.010) and lymph node metastases (P=0.014). High COX-2 expression was detected in 14.3% of the carcinosarcomas (carcinoma and/or sarcoma cells) and 27.3% of the sarcomas. The carcinosarcomas and sarcomas had similar clinical and pathological characteristics and developed as large tumors, with intratumoral necrosis and a predominance of high histologic grades, although the frequency of vascular invasion and lymph node metastasis was low. Osteosarcoma subtypes presented more aggressive characteristics than non-osteosarcoma subtypes.

Background: Hepatocellular carcinoma is a primary malignant tumor of the liver tissue and its occurrence in birds is considered rare. The tumor can occur as a single mass leading to hepatomegaly, or as multiple nodules in the liver. In animals of the genus Amazona, only 1 case of metastatic hepatocellular carcinoma has been reported in the United States, therefore, little is known about its epidemiology and clinicopathological aspects in these species. In this context, the aim of this work was to describe a case of metastatic hepatocellular carcinoma in an Amazona aestiva. Case: A blue-fronted amazon parrot (Amazona aestiva) was referred to necropsy after being found dead in its enclosure. On examination, it presented cachectic body score. Examination of the coelomic cavity, revealed a serous translucent fluid and adhesions between the liver and peritoneum.A red mass restricted to the right hepatic lobe and raised to the capsular surface, interspersed with whitish and dark red multifocal areas was observed. When cut, this mass was soft, protruding, multilobulated, whitish and with a friable reddish center. Additionally, on the dorsal surface of the left lung lobe, there was a rounded, well defined, whitish, and soft nodule. Microscopically, partial replacement of the hepatic parenchyma was observed by neoplastic proliferation of cuboidal epithelial cells, organized in mantle and supported by a scarce fibrovascular stroma. Cells have large, eosinophilic, well-delimited cytoplasm, with a central, oval nucleus, loose chromatin, and evident nucleolus. Moderate pleomorphism was characterized by anisocytosis, anisokaryosis, and aberrant nuclei. In the lung, a focally extensive mass with a pattern similar to that seen in the liver was observed. In the kidney, multifocal neoplastic emboli were noted. Liver immunohistochemistry was performed. Positive and negative controls were used to validate the reaction; however, there was no immunolabelling for the evaluated antibodies. Discussion: The histopathological characteristics observed in this study favored the diagnosis of hepatocellular carcinoma (HCC) with metastasis to kidney and lung. Primary liver tumors are rare in wild birds. In ducks, experimental studies have pointed aflatoxins and the duck hepatitis B virus as oncogenic agents, however, in birds of the genus Amazona, there are no studies that evaluate predisposing factors to the development of liver carcinoma. Macroscopically, hepatocellular carcinoma may present in massive, nodular or diffuse forms. In birds, the right lobe is the largest, which may suggest that this lobe is more prone to the development of HCC, as seen in the present case. The solid form, similar to that observed in this report, seems to be more commonly observed, as seen in the wild bird reports consulted. Metastases most often spread hematogenous, and in the present report there was metastasis to kidneys and lungs, which is a common feature for this neoplasm. In the present case, there was no labeling by any of the antibodies, perhaps because of their aggressiveness, associated with autolytic factors that prevent the labeling of antibodies, in addition to the specificity in the antibodyantigen relationship. This tumor must be differentiated from other liver tumors such as cholangiocarcinoma, and also the well-differentiated hepatocellular adenoma, in addition to non-neoplastic conditions. HCC should be considered as a differential diagnosis for Amazona aestiva found dead in the enclosure without previous clinical signs. This neoplasm is rare in Amazon parrots and reports should be encouraged in order to contribute to the understanding of the epidemiological and clinicopathological aspects of the tumor.

Background: In the literature, there are a few descriptions of epididymis neoplasia in domestic animals, especially considering primary tumors. In the few reports found in literature, the lesions were a consequence of the invasion of testicular or paratesticular neoplasia, as a papillar carcinoma in a dog's and a bull's epididymis, and mesenchymal tumors - fibrome/ fibrosarcoma, leiomyoma/leiosarcome. On the other hand, mast cell tumors are the second most prevalent neoplasia in dogs in Brazil, affecting especially the skin. The aim of this report is to describe for the first time a low malignancy mast cell tumor in a mixed-breed dog's epididymis, without metastasis or recurrence in a 2-year follow-up period. Case: A 10-year-old male mixed-breed dog was presented for pre-surgical evaluation for elective orchiectomy. In the physical examination, an increase in the volume of approximately 2 cm with an irregular appearance was identified on palpation in the cranial pole of the left testis. In the trans surgical period, an increase in testicular volume (4 cm long x 2 cm wide) was observed, with a firm consistency in the region of the vas deferens with macroscopic changes in the region. The testis was sectioned, and the fragments were sent for histopathological evaluation in 10% buffered formaldehyde. There was a fairly cellular circumscribed neoplastic infiltrate, distributed in a sheet and separated by fibrovascular stroma, and rounded neoplastic cells with a moderate amount of basophilic cytoplasmic granulation, and discrete anisocytosis and anisokaryosis. The nuclei were rounded with vesicular chromatin with 1 or 2 distinct nucleoli. No mitosis figures were observed in 10 high power fields (400x). Few eosinophils were distributed throughout the neoplastic cell population. Immunohistochemistry demonstrated immunostaining for KIT protein with perimembranous staining in 95% of neoplastic mast cells, giving a KIT 1 pattern. There was no positive nuclear staining for Ki67 in any cell of the histological sections examined. A grade II mast cell tumor (low grade of malignancy) was diagnosed. After diagnosis, the animal underwent radiographic evaluation of the chest and abdominal ultrasound, and a new physical inspection in search of nodules, plaques, skin lesions, or subcutaneous masses. There were no metastases in the thorax and abdominal cavity, nor physical alterations, and it can be inferred that the epididymis was the primary site of the mast cell tumor. After 2 years of orchiectomy, there were no recurrences, and no chemotherapy treatment was performed. Discussion: Extracutaneous mast cell tumors are uncommon in animals, but have been reported in oral and nasal mucosa, nasopharynx, larynx, trachea, intestine, visceral lymph nodes, spleen, liver, spinal cord, intestine, ureter, conjunctiva, lung and more recently in tear gland of the third eyelid. However, in the authors' assessment, this is the first description of mast cell tumor in the epididymis in dogs. The diagnosis was established by histopathological examination, which revealed a grade II epididymal mast cell tumor and immunohistochemical evaluation (KIT and Ki-67) as being of low aggressiveness. The diagnosis of a primary tumor was confirmed since the staging was established after the histopathological diagnosis, involving chest radiography, abdominal ultrasound, cutaneous evaluation in search of nodules, plaques, cutaneous and subcutaneous lesions, and did not reveal other abnormalities or metastases not identified in the preoperative evaluation. In addition, immunostaining with KIT and Ki-67 reaffirmed the low degree of malignancy and the potential for metastases, which can be observed by the asymptomatic follow-up of the patient 2 years after the surgical excision.

Background: Thyroid tumor is a common endocrine tumor that accounts for up to 3.8% of all tumors in dogs. Most of them are malignant and usually nonfunctional in dogs. 18F-fluorodeoxyglucose positron emission tomography (FDG-PET) is an imaging modality that detects intracellular accumulation of radioactive deoxyglucose administered in the body and is used in combination with computed tomography to provide functional information with exact anatomical localization. It is used in human medicine to detect residual or recurrent head and neck neoplasm after treatments, such as surgical resection. This report describes the first case of diagnosing recurrent thyroid carcinoma (TC) through FDG-PET in a dog. Case: A 9-year-old castrated male Maltese dog presented with a palpable mobile mass in the right ventral cervical region. Radiography and ultrasonography (US) showed a radiopaque mass adjacent to the trachea, and the right thyroid gland was enlarged on computed tomography. The surgically excised mass was encapsulated and measured to be 2.3 × 1.0 × 3.4 cm (width x length x height) in size. Histopathologically, the mass was diagnosed as differentiated follicular TC, and gross and vascular invasions were observed. To prevent recurrence, postoperative carboplatin chemotherapy was performed for 5 months. Two months after completion of chemotherapy, a nodule of approximately 7 mm in diameter was detected in the thyroidectomy bed by US. FDG-PET scanning was performed as an effective means of evaluating the malignancy, local recurrence, and metastasis of differentiated follicular TC. The nodule had the dimensions of 2.8 × 5.9 × 8.6 mm, a maximum standardized uptake value (SUV) of 8.49, and a mean SUV of 5.6. The results of FDG-PET suggested the recurrence of TC; therefore, the second chemotherapy protocol using toceranib was applied for 16 months. After initiation of the 2nd chemotherapy, follow-up examinations were conducted approximately every 4 months. On the 134th day, although the nodule was not palpated, its size was observed to have increased to 5.0 × 3.8 × 13.6 mm on cervical US on the 232nd day, showing heterogeneous and hypoechoic parenchyma. On the 405th day, the tumor was enlarged to a size of 13.4 × 12.9 × 22 mm and identified as a lobular, amorphous shape, and its heterogeneity was increased. Moreover, 2 pulmonary nodules with well-defined margins were found on radiography in the left caudal lung lobe (9 × 10 mm and 12 × 12 mm [width × length]); thus, lung metastasis was suspected. On the 536th day, anorexia and lethargy occurred, and the dog was lost to follow-up. Discussion: In the present case, local recurrence of TC was suspected based on cervical US. Although US was useful as a screening tool, additional examinations were necessary for evaluating local invasiveness, malignancy, and nodal/distant metastasis. FDG-PET can detect recurrence at an early stage because it can sense increased tumor metabolism through physiologic absorption of FDG, even before the beginning of anatomic change in the lesion. Therefore, FDG-PET can assist in treatment planning and provide better prognosis. In humans, focal FDG uptake and a high maximum SUV in the thyroid gland on FDG-PET were associated with a higher risk of cancer. Because there was no evidence of neoplasia except the thyroid lesion during the FDG-PET examination, the tumor showed an increasingly malignant pattern of the thyroid gland on US during the follow-up period, and the metastatic pulmonary nodules were identified on the 650th day after the thyroidectomy, the present case was diagnosed as recurrent TC. This report describes the use of FDG-PET for diagnosing local recurrence of TC, pointing to FDG-PET as a potential strategy to evaluate loco-regional recurrence and distant metastasis of TC.

Histiocytic sarcoma (HS) is uncommon malignant neoplasia of round cells with marked predilection in Rottweiler and Bernese Mountain. The disseminated form, which mainly affects the spleen, lungs, lymph nodes, bone marrow, skin, and subcutis, presents a quick and aggressive clinical behavior. Hemangiosarcoma (HAS) is a malignant neoplasm of endothelial vessel cells commonly reported to affect the right atrium of dogs' hearts. A male Rottweiler, five years old, presented flaccid paraplegia and progressive muscular atrophy in the temporal, masseter, and limbs muscles; Due to the clinical stage of the animal, euthanasia was conducted. During the necroscopic examination, it was noticed that several masses presented different sizes; some were whitish, and others were reddish and spread in multiple organs (lungs, heart, spleen, stomach, kidneys, brain, medulla, skeletal muscle, and pre-scapular lymph node). Microscopically, in some organs such as the stomach, right ventricle, lungs, and medulla, it was noticed a proliferation of myeloid cells, highly cellular, with poor demarcation, no encapsulation, and with the infiltrative growth pattern of cells with high pleomorphism. Numerous tumoral emboli were observed in the spleen, brain, skeletal muscle, and lymph node. These cells were submitted for immunohistochemistry and were positive for CD18 (HS antibody). In the right atrium, liver, and kidney it was observed malignant and infiltrative endothelial proliferation (HSA) and emboli in the medulla. Therefore, we conclude that both neoplasms (HS and HSA) cause the animal's paraplegia due to their embolism and metastasis to the spinal cord and skeletal muscle.(AU)

Abstract Oral squamous cell carcinoma (OSCC) is a malignant tumour of Head and Neck Cancer (HNC). The recent therapeutic approaches used to treat cancer have adverse side effects. The natural agents exhibiting anticancer activities are generally considered to have a robust therapeutic potential. Curcuminoids, one of the major active compounds of the turmeric herb, are used as a therapeutic agent for several diseases including cancer. In this study, the cytotoxicity of curcuminoids was investigated against OSCC cell line HNO97. Our data showed that curcuminoids significantly inhibits the proliferation of HNO97 in a time and dose-dependent manner (IC50=35 M). Cell cycle analysis demonstrated that curcuminoids increased the percentage of G2/M phase cell populations in the treated groups. Treating HNO97 cells with curcuminoids led to cell shrinking and increased detached cells, which are the typical appearance of apoptotic cells. Moreover, flow cytometry analysis revealed that curcuminoids significantly induced apoptosis in a time-dependent manner. Furthermore, as a response to curcuminoids treatment, comet tails were formed in cell nuclei due to the induction of DNA damage. Curcuminoids treatment reduced the colony formation capacity of HNO97 cells and induced morphological changes. Overall, these findings demonstrate that curcuminoids can in vitro inhibit HNC proliferation and metastasis and induce apoptosis.

The aim of this study was to describe the clinical and morphological characteristics of mixed mammary neoplasms and verify what characteristics affect the prognosis of female dogs with carcinomas in mixed tumors and carcinosarcomas. This was a retrospective study of 67 female dogs that underwent mastectomies and were diagnosed with benign mixed tumors (n=13), carcinomas in mixed tumors (n=44) and carcinosarcomas (n=10). Data regarding the clinical and histological aspects of the neoplasms were collected and the relation with specific survival times, and hazard ratios (HR) in 24 months was calculated. In univariate analysis, the diagnosis of carcinosarcoma (HR 8.26, p=0.006), carcinomatous areas with micropapillary or solid patterns (HR 17.49; p=0. 001) and lymph node metastasis (HR 7.07;p=0.020) were associated with specific survival. In multivariable analysis, only micropapillary or solid pattern (HR=16.34; p=0.007) remained independent factor associated with lower specific survival. Micropapillary or solid carcinomatous patterns were associated with shorter specific survival time (p=0.002) among animals with carcinomas in mixed tumors. Among the carcinosarcomas, lymph node metastasis (p=0.010) was associated with a shorter specific survival time. In conclusion, carcinomas in mixed tumors and carcinosarcomas vary in prognosis depending on the carcinomatous proliferation patterns and spread of the disease.

Abstract Colorectal cancer (CRC) is a disease with high incidence worldwide. As of 2018, it is the second leading cause of cancer deaths in the world. In Saudi Arabia, the incidence of this disease has been increasing in the younger population. Both genetic and lifestyle factors may have contributed to its increased incidence and pathogenesis. Monosodium glutamate (MSG) is a food flavor enhancer that can be found in many commercial foods, and it can sometimes be used as a substitute to table salt. MSG has been investigated for its possible genotoxicity, yielding controversial results. In the present study, the effect of MSG on cell viability and its effect on expression of APC, BECN1, and TP53 genes in SW620 and SW480 colon cancer cell lines were studied. TP53 is a tumor suppressor gene that functions in modifying DNA errors and/or inducing apoptosis of damaged cells, and both APC and BECN1 genes are involved in CRC and are of importance in cellular growth and metastasis. Cancer cell viability was analyzed using MTT assay, and the results showed a significant increase in the number of viable cells after 24 h of treatment with MSG with different concentrations (0.5, 1.0, 10, 50, and 100mM). Moreover, gene expression results showed a significant increase in the expression levels of APC and BECN1 under specified conditions in both cell lines; conversely, TP53 showed a significant decrease in expression in SW620 cells. Thus, it can be concluded that MSG possibly confers a pro-proliferative effect on CRC cells.

Among the diseases that cause dyspnea in felines, primary pulmonary neoplasia is rare and tends to affect senile cats. This study reports the case of a seven teen year old FeLV infected cat who was diagnosed acinar adenocarcinoma of the lung and kidney metastasis. It presented prostration and anorexia and was hospitalized with dyspnea and pleural effusion. Chest radiography indicated increased radiopacity in the cranial portion of the right hemithorax, compatible with presence of intrathoracic mass and the cytologic analysis of pleural effusion suggested feline infectious peritonitis. The animal died two days after, and the definitive diagnosis was concluded after necropsy and histopathological examination. Pulmonary adenocarcinoma should be included with differential diagnosis of respiratory diseases in cats, especially the elderly.

Background: Multilobular tumor of bone (MTB) is an unusual neoplasm with variable biologic behavior which originates primarily in bone tissues. Radiographs computed tomography (CT), and magnetic resonance imaging (MRI) are useful in diagnoses and surgical planning. Tumor removal with wide surgical margins is the treatment of choice. Immunohistochemistry has been shown as an important tool in veterinary oncology to define therapeutic and prognostic decisions. The goal of this study was to report 2 distinct cases of multilobular tumor of bone, their Cox-2 and Mib-1 immunohistochemical profile and its impact on overall survival. Case: Two bitches were presented at the Oncology Department of the Veterinary Hospital in the Veterinary School of Universidade Federal de Minas Gerais (UFMG). Both had a history of a progressive, painless, circumscribed, and firm facial mass. The 1st patient was a 8-year-old intact bitch mixed breed, weighing 50 kg, that presented a fast growing right infraorbital 3-cm mass, causing eye displacement. The 2nd patient was a 7-year-old spayed bitch Labrador retriever, weighing 28 kg, that presented a left temporal 8-cm mass. Neurologic examination of both bitches was normal. Skin over the nodules was strained, but with no ulceration. Radiographic exams of the head revealed lytic and proliferative bone reaction, with loss of cortical definition in both cases. These alterations were seen on the left zygomatic arch of the retrobulbar region, involving part of the mandible and of the nasal sinus lateral frontal bone in 1st patient, and on the right temporal process of the zygomatic bone in 2nd patient. The last one, also showed a granular solid mass with little contact with skull bones. Complete blood count, biochemistry profile, electrocardiogram, and 3-view thoracic radiographs were performed. Results were within normal ranges for the species and no signs of metastasis was seen on the radiographs. Location, size, and density of the mass, adjacent tissue compression, absence of cranial invasion, and lymph node size were rigorously evaluated with CT, allowing an individualized surgical planning to achieve complete mass removal and maintenance of the function of adjacent structures. Both animals were submitted to surgery. Both tumors were fixed on 10% neutral buffered formalin and sent to the Animal Pathology Department of UFMG for histopathological examination and margin assessment. Both tumors were diagnosed as grade I MTB. Tumor immunohistochemistry was performed to identify prognostic factors that could be used to better define therapeutic treatments and to try to clarify the discrepancy in disease progression between both tumors. The 1st patient expressed 20% of Mib-1 and was considered score 2 of Cox-2. The 2nd one expressed 5% of Mib-1 and was considered score 1 of Cox-2. Considering the diagnoses and histological characteristics of the tumors, it was decided for clinical follow-up of patients without additional therapeutic complementation. Even considering incomplete surgical margins in 2nd patient, adjuvant chemotherapy was not performed, due to low mitotic index and low histological grade. The 1st patient had an overall survival of 240 days, and death was due to recurrence and disease progression; and the 2nd did not show recurrence nor metastasis after 1200 days. Discussion: Proper and individualized surgical planning and histopathological evaluation are extremely important to guide treatment decisions. However, immunohistochemistry can be important in MTB cases, to help define which patients should be submitted to surgery alone and which patients could be benefited from adjuvant chemotherapy.

Background: Primary lung neoplasms are uncommon in veterinary medicine, and when they develop, they are more frequently observed to be of epithelial origin. Although chondrosarcomas are the second most diagnosed type of neoplasm in dogs at skeletal sites, their development in extraskeletal tissues, including the spleen, aorta, heart, tongue, peritoneum, and lungs, corresponds to approximately only 1% of cases. Therefore, the occurrence of primary pulmonary chondrosarcoma is considered very rare in domestic animals. Considering the rare occurrence and scarcity of data regarding its development, the present report describes the clinical and pathological aspects of a case of primary pulmonary chondrosarcoma in a bitch. Case: A 8-year-old mixed-breed bitch, weighing 14.2 kg, was examined at one private veterinary clinic with the principal complaint of prolonged respiratory distress and resistance to exercise. Clinical evaluation revealed tachypnea with expiratory dyspnea due to intense pleural effusion, tachycardia, and diffusely pale mucous membranes. Thoracocentesis was performed with drainage of 1000 mL of modified transudate, and fluid cytology, blood count, and chest radiography were performed. Cytological analysis of the thoracic fluid did not identify neoplastic cells, the blood count showed intense regenerative anemia, and the radiograph showed an extensive area of consolidation in the left caudal lung lobe, compatible with neoplasia. The results of the tests performed, in addition to the evolution of the clinical picture and the impossibility of performing the indicated surgical intervention, culminated in the patient's unfavorable prognosis, followed by euthanasia, necropsy, and histopathological evaluation of the collected material. Necropsy revealed a white neoplastic formation with reddish areas and firm consistency that diffused into the parenchyma of the left caudal lung lobe with invasion of the rib cage, fracture of the fifth and sixth left ribs, diaphragmatic metastasis, intense hydrothorax, and moderate hydroperitoneum. Microscopically, in the histological sections of the lung and diaphragm, poorly differentiated mesenchymal cells with moderate anisocytosis and anisokaryosis and interspersed with them, moderately differentiated chondrocytes surrounded by chondroid matrix, moderate anisocytosis and anisokaryosis, and a low mitotic index culminated in the diagnosis of primary pulmonary mesenchymal chondrosarcoma. Discussion: Malignant epithelial neoplasms were suspected; however, the histopathological features observed were compatible with primary pulmonary chondrosarcoma. The characteristics of the fluid collected through thoracentesis led to its classification as a modified transudate, which is often associated with neoplastic and hemorrhagic processes; both alterations were present in this case. The diagnosis of primary pulmonary chondrosarcoma was established based on the histopathological findings since the cell type and distribution observed in the present case were compatible with the typical pattern observed in extraskeletal chondrosarcomas. An unfavorable prognosis is common in cases of primary or metastatic lung neoplasm since, in most cases, the condition is identified in the advanced stages of the disease, making therapeutic management challenging. Given the increase in the number of dog deaths due to neoplasms in recent years, this case report may contribute to a better understanding of the biological behavior of pulmonary chondrosarcoma and assist in the choice of treatment to be adopted when required.

Mammary neoplasms represent the third most common neoplasm in queens, while in tomcats the incidence is rare. This study reports the case of a tomcat, not neutered, treated at the Veterinary Hospital of the State University of Ceará, with a mammary neoformation. The initial diagnosis, obtained through aspiration cytology, suggested the presence of mammary carcinoma. Imaging tests such as thoracic radiography and abdominal ultrasound, did not show the presence of metastasis in the lung parenchyma and abdominal organs, respectively. The chosen treatment was the surgical removal of the neoformation, using the bilateral partial mastectomy technique. Histopathological examination of the mass showed a mammary fibroepithelial hyperplasia. Therefore, it is concluded that, although rare, mammary neoformations in male cats can occur, thus, it should be part of the list of differential diagnoses for increases in volume in the ventral region of these animals.(AU)

Background: Hematological analyses are seen as more preferred laboratory analyses in canine transmissible venereal tumor studies. There is no information about the availability of platelets and their indices in routine practice in canine transmissible venereal tumor cases. Taking this as a starting point, this study analyzed the usefulness of platelet indices in dogs with transmissible venereal tumor in clinical laboratory diagnosis as well as examined the relationship between white blood cells, red blood cells, platelets (PLT), main platelet volume (MPV), platelet distribution width (PDW), plateletcrit (PCT), and the ratio of main platelet volume to platelets (MPV/PLT). Materials, Methods & Results: In the study, a total of 42 bitches of various breeds were used. Nineteen healthy bitches were used as a control group, and the others 23 with cTVT as a study group. Metastasis was not observed in any of the bitches involved in the study. History, clinical findings, and cytological examinations were evaluated for the diagnosis of cTVT. In animals with hemorrhagic discharge and neoplastic lesions, a vaginal cytological examination was performed. Typical TVT cells with large nuclei and intracytoplasmic vacuoles were observed in the vaginal cytological examinations, and the diagnosis of TVT was made. Healthy bitches (19) and those with TVT (23) were 39.16 5.37 months and 47.61 5.14 months old, respectively. From all animals, 2 mL blood samples were collected from V. cephalica to evaluate PIs in the complete blood count (CBC). Collected blood samples were analyzed using an automated hematology analyzer. As a result of the analysis, WBC, RBC, HGB, HCT, MCV, MCHC, RDW, PLT, MPV, PDW, PCT, and MPV/PLT data were obtained. Mild leukocytosis, an increase in PLT, and a decrease in MCV and MPV/PLT were determined in the study group compared to the control group. Cut-off values in CBC of bitches with TVT were determined as WBC: 13.35 (sensitivity: 78%; specificity: 90%); MCV: 67 (sensitivity: 57%; specificity: 95%); PLT: 315.50 (sensitivity: 65%; specificity: 74%); and MPV/PLT: 0.028 (sensitivity: 78%; specificity: 58%). In CBC analyses, a strong negative correlation between PLT and MPV/PLT was detected in both groups. Discussion: Canine transmissible venereal tumors are common in both stray and pet dogs. It is naturally transferred from animal to animal during mating by live tumor cells. This tumor can commonly affect the external genitalia and internal organs in some cases. It generally has the look of cauliflower, and its surface is ulcerated, inflammatory, hemorrhagic, and infectious. More preferred laboratory analyses are complete blood count and blood chemistry analysis in cTVT for to evaluate the success of treatments. Platelet indices have been investigated in many diseases such as endotoxemia, chronic enteropathy, mammary tumor, parvoviral enteritis, septic peritonitis, lymphoma, pyometra, visceral leishmaniasis, and babesiosis in dogs. There is no information available for either diagnostic or prognostic use of the PIs in canine TVT cases. Ultimately, in light of the presented study's results, platelet indices, especially PLT and the MPV/PLT ratio, seem to be notable laboratory markers in terms of easy accessibility and low-cost assessment techniques in canine transmissible venereal tumor cases. New data, however, should be established by a thorough follow-up study using a larger sample size and addressing its usefulness as a diagnostic or prognostic marker in canine transmissible venereal tumors.
